CHICAGO (WLS) -- A Chicago police officer was injured by a firework in a bathroom Monday morning in the Albany Park neighborhood.
A male officer went into the restroom in the 4600 block of North Pulaski and came into contact with a novelty firework at 5:50 a.m., Chicago police said.
The officer was taken to Swedish Covenant Hospital in good condition. The bathroom was not damaged.
